                2025 Fantasy Outlook
                
                    Odom was one of the guys that head coach Scotty Walden brought with him from Austin Peay. The move from the FCS to the FBS didn't hinder Odom at all. In fact, his numbers were even better at the FBS level. Odom had 46 catches for 741 yards and eight touchdowns with the Miners. Now, he's had a chance to acclimate himself to FBS football. The same goes for Scotty Walden, whose dynamic offense needed to be tweaked for the increase in oppositional talent. If everything breaks right for the Miners and for Odom, he could be in for a big season. The only question is the presence of Kam Thomas, another APSU transfer, who had 47 catches for 532 yards and two scores across just nine games. That being said, if everything breaks as it could for Walden, this passing game should sustain production for two receivers, and Odom at 5-foot-10 is more of an end-zone threat than Thomas, who stands at just 5-foot-7, 184 pounds. 				  Out for season
Thomas (knee) will miss the rest of the 2025 season, according to Bret Bloomquist of the El Paso Times.
				  ANALYSIS
Thomas hasn't played since the Miners' opener, and now it's been confirmed he won't return for the rest of the campaign. Thomas ends the campaign with 16 carries for 36 yards and four catches for 26 receiving yards. Expect Hahsaun Wilson to continue as the lead back for UTEP.
